KUWAIT CITY — Kuwait registered on Friday 825 new COVID-18 cases over the past 24 hours, taking the total number of confirmed infections in the country to 130,463, according to a statement from the Ministry of Health carried by state news agency KUNA.

The ministry also announced that five more patients died due to complications caused by the deadly virus, raising the total number of fatalities to 804.

According to the ministry’s spokesman Dr. Abdullah Al-Sanad, there are currently 8,396 active cases in the country out of which 115 are receiving treatment in intensive care units.

A total of 7,526 tests were conducted over the past 24 hours, taking the total number of COVID-19 examinations in the country so far to 955,477, Dr. Al-Sanad said.

Earlier in the day, the ministry announced that a total of 699 more patients have recovered from COVID-19 over the past 24 hours, bringing the total number of recoveries in the country to 121,263. — SG
